Degassers are used in High-Performance Liquid Chromatography (HPLC) separations to reduce dissolved air from the mobile phase solvent. The mobile phase state will aid in the proper identification of compounds separated by the HPLC system, along with the stability of the system flow rate. For this reason, nearly all HPLC systems include some form of degassing of the mobile phase and, in some cases, a separate degasser channel is used to improve the accuracy of the autosampler.
